闪光灯的曝光控制方法及系统、设备、介质、产品、芯片与流程

文档序号:38751675发布日期:2024-07-24 22:56阅读:17来源:国知局
闪光灯的曝光控制方法及系统、设备、介质、产品、芯片与流程

本公开涉及自动曝光控制领域,尤其涉及一种闪光灯的曝光控制方法及系统、设备、介质、产品、芯片。


背景技术:

1、随着智能手机和拍照设备的发展,夜景闪光灯拍照功能越来越受到关注。其中闪光灯自动曝光使拍摄图像具有合适的亮度,是高质量、高清晰度成像的基础。闪光灯流程主要分为两个阶段:预闪和主闪,通常做法是通过预闪获取到的信息来估算主闪时的电流档位和曝光参数。但是在一些动态场景如车来车往的公路、闪烁的背景灯光等场景,使用闪光灯拍照多次,由于每次预闪时背景灯光或者拍摄主体在变化,导致估算主闪时的电流档位和曝光参数也在变化,造成图像亮度不稳定,概率性出现图像偏亮或偏暗的情况。

2、目前的拍照设备如手机,在进行闪光灯拍照时,会先打开闪光灯的预闪,之后关闭预闪,根据之前计算出来的电流档位打开主闪,并应用之前计算得到的曝光参数,使拍下来的图像具有合适的亮度。但是在拍摄车来车往的路边等动态场景时,由于预闪时的图像内容一直在变化,导致每次拍照时预闪目标亮度和收敛稳定后的raw图亮度都不一致,使得估算出的主闪电流档位和曝光参数也不一致,造成图像亮度不一致。


技术实现思路

1、本公开要解决的技术问题是为了克服现有技术中无法准确计算主闪曝光参数的缺陷,提供一种闪光灯的曝光控制方法及系统、设备、介质、产品、芯片。

2、本公开是通过下述技术方案来解决上述技术问题:

3、第一方面,提供一种闪光灯的曝光控制方法,曝光控制方法包括:

4、响应于闪光灯预闪时的图像亮度与预设亮度的差值小于差值阈值,获取图像传感器采集的至少两张目标图像;

5、将每张目标图像的亮度统计区域中剔除了目标区域后的亮度统计区域确定为目标局部区域;所述目标区域为不满足预设亮度的区域;

6、根据一次预闪得到的至少两张目标图像的目标局部区域的亮度信息,确定预闪时的图像亮度信息;

7、根据闪光灯预闪时马达的位置信息以及图像亮度信息,确定闪光灯主闪时的曝光参数。

8、可选地,所述将每张目标图像的亮度统计区域中剔除了目标区域后的亮度统计区域确定为目标局部区域,包括:

9、获取每张目标图像的亮度统计区域,并将所述亮度统计区域分为至少两个局部区域;

10、对于除第一张目标图像外的任意单张目标图像,将所述至少两个局部区域和第一张目标图像的相同部位的局部区域进行相似度计算,得到对应于各个局部区域的相似度计算结果;

11、将相似度计算结果小于相似度阈值的局部区域确定为目标区域,并将剔除了目标区域后的亮度统计区域确定为目标局部区域。

12、可选地,所述根据一次预闪得到的至少两张目标图像的目标局部区域的亮度信息,确定图像亮度信息,包括:

13、获取一次预闪得到的至少两张目标图像的目标局部区域的亮度信息;

14、对至少两张目标图像的亮度信息进行均值计算,得到图像亮度信息;

15、和/或,

16、获取一次预闪得到的至少两张目标图像的目标局部区域的亮度信息;

17、对至少两张目标图像的亮度信息进行加权计算,得到图像亮度信息。

18、可选地,所述响应于闪光灯预闪时的图像亮度与预设亮度的差值小于差值阈值,获取图像传感器采集的至少两张目标图像之前,还包括:

19、基于闪光灯预闪前的环境亮度确定闪光灯主闪时的电流档位;

20、所述根据闪光灯预闪时马达的位置信息以及图像亮度信息,确定闪光灯主闪时的曝光参数,包括:

21、根据所述马达的位置信息、闪光灯主闪时的电流档位以及图像亮度信息,确定闪光灯主闪时的曝光参数。

22、可选地,所述响应于闪光灯预闪时的图像亮度与预设亮度的差值小于差值阈值,获取图像传感器采集的至少两张目标图像之前,还包括:

23、获取闪光灯预闪前的图像亮度和曝光参数;

24、获取闪光灯预闪时和主闪时的图像亮度差值;所述根据闪光灯预闪时马达的位置信息以及图像亮度信息,确定闪光灯主闪时的曝光参数之前,还包括:

25、获取马达的位置信息;

26、确定所述马达的位置信息的权重;

27、根据所述马达的位置信息的权重和所述图像亮度差值的乘积,确定闪光灯主闪灯光对图像亮度的第一影响度;

28、所述根据闪光灯预闪时马达的位置信息以及图像亮度信息,确定闪光灯主闪时的曝光参数,包括:

29、基于闪光灯预闪前的图像亮度和曝光参数的商,确定环境亮度对图像亮度的第二影响度;

30、根据所述第一影响度、所述第二影响度以及所述图像亮度信息,确定主闪时的曝光参数。

31、第二方面,提供一种曝光控制系统,所述曝光控制系统包括:

32、获取模块,用于响应于闪光灯预闪时的图像亮度与预设亮度的差值小于差值阈值,获取图像传感器采集的至少两张目标图像;

33、剔除模块,用于将每张目标图像的亮度统计区域中剔除了目标区域后的亮度统计区域确定为目标局部区域;所述目标区域为不满足预设亮度的区域;

34、亮度确定模块,用于根据一次预闪得到的至少两张目标图像的目标局部区域的亮度信息,确定预闪时的图像亮度信息;

35、参数确定模块,用于根据闪光灯预闪时马达的位置信息以及图像亮度信息,确定闪光灯主闪时的曝光参数。

36、第三方面,提供一种电子设备,包括存储器、处理器及存储在存储器上并用于在处理器上运行的计算机程序,所述处理器执行所述计算机程序时实现第一方面所述的曝光控制方法。

37、第四方面,提供一种计算机可读存储介质,其上存储有计算机程序,所述计算机程序被处理器执行时实现第一方面所述的曝光控制方法。

38、第五方面,提供一种计算机程序产品,包括计算机程序,所述计算机程序被处理器执行时实现第一方面所述的曝光控制方法。

39、第六方面,提供一种芯片,应用于电子设备,所述芯片用于执行如第一方面所述的曝光控制方法。

40、第七方面,提供一种芯片模组,应用于电子设备,包括收发组件和芯片,所述芯片用于执行如第一方面所述的曝光控制方法。

41、在符合本领域常识的基础上,上述各优选条件,可任意组合,即得本公开各较佳实例。

42、本公开的积极进步效果在于:基于闪光灯预闪时的图像亮度信息和马达的位置信息,确定主闪的曝光参数,通过剔除不满足预设亮度的区域,减少每张目标图像中变化内容的占比,增大目标图像中固定不变的内容例如背景的占比,减少拍照时由于图像内容变化造成的亮度差异,通过马达的位置信息辨别近景和远景,减小远景中主闪灯光对图像亮度影响的权重,增大近景中主闪灯光对图像亮度影响的权重,使估算出的主闪电流档位和主闪曝光参数较为准确,提高主闪时获取的图像亮度的准确度,使拍下来的图像具有合适的亮度。



技术特征:

1.一种闪光灯的曝光控制方法,其特征在于,所述曝光控制方法包括:

2.如权利要求1所述的曝光控制方法,其特征在于,所述将每张目标图像的亮度统计区域中剔除了目标区域后的亮度统计区域确定为目标局部区域,包括:

3.如权利要求1所述的曝光控制方法,其特征在于,所述根据一次预闪得到的至少两张目标图像的目标局部区域的亮度信息,确定图像亮度信息,包括:

4.如权利要求1所述的曝光控制方法,其特征在于,所述响应于闪光灯预闪时的图像亮度与预设亮度的差值小于差值阈值,获取图像传感器采集的至少两张目标图像之前,还包括:

5.如权利要求1所述的曝光控制方法,其特征在于,所述响应于闪光灯预闪时的图像亮度与预设亮度的差值小于差值阈值,获取图像传感器采集的至少两张目标图像之前,还包括:

6.一种曝光控制系统,其特征在于,所述曝光控制系统包括:

7.一种电子设备,包括存储器、处理器及存储在存储器上并用于在处理器上运行的计算机程序,其特征在于,所述处理器执行所述计算机程序时实现权利要求1至5中任一项所述的曝光控制方法。

8.一种计算机可读存储介质,其上存储有计算机程序,其特征在于,所述计算机程序被处理器执行时实现权利要求1至5中任一项所述的曝光控制方法。

9.一种计算机程序产品,包括计算机程序,其特征在于,所述计算机程序被处理器执行时实现如权利要求1-5中任一项所述的曝光控制方法。

10.一种芯片,应用于电子设备,其特征在于,所述芯片用于执行如权利要求1-5中任一项所述的曝光控制方法。

11.一种芯片模组,应用于电子设备,其特征在于,包括收发组件和芯片,所述芯片用于执行如权利要求1-5中任一项所述的曝光控制方法。


技术总结
本公开提供了一种闪光灯的曝光控制方法及系统、设备、介质、产品、芯片,曝光控制方法包括:响应于闪光灯预闪时的图像亮度与预设亮度的差值小于差值阈值,获取图像传感器采集的至少两张目标图像;将每张目标图像的亮度统计区域中剔除了局部区域后的亮度统计区域确定为目标局部区域;局部区域为不满足预设亮度的区域;根据一次预闪得到的至少两张目标图像的目标局部区域的亮度信息,确定图像亮度信息;根据闪光灯预闪时马达的位置信息以及图像亮度信息,确定闪光灯主闪时的曝光参数。本公开通过剔除不满足预设亮度的区域,减少拍照时由于图像内容变化造成的亮度差异,提高主闪时获取的图像亮度的准确度,使拍下来的图像具有合适的亮度。

技术研发人员:李洋洋,游瑞蓉,刘瑞,许晶晶
受保护的技术使用者:展讯半导体(南京)有限公司
技术研发日:
技术公布日:2024/7/23
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1